Hello,
Maybe this has already been discussed, but I can't look through the relay option with the RaQ2, maybe someone can explain it for
me........
In my relay list there are the names of all virtual sites hosted on this server and their IP addresses.
Now, the following scenario
* I want to send an email to afriend@xxxxxxxxxxx
* This email should be sent with my email@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x email address
* a-virtualsite.com is hosted my server
* I have a dial-up Internet account with a local ISP, and my IP address is NOT listed in the relay field (as I already said, only
the names and IPs of the virtual sites are in there).
Now, the strange thing is this behaviour:
When I send an email to afriend@xxxxxxxxxxx (inrussia.ru is NOT hosted on my server), I get the "Relaying denied" error. If I add
"inrussia.ru" OR "ru" to my relay list, the mail can be sent without any problems, although my IP address (that I get from my ISP
everytime I dial-in) is NOT listed. Shouldn't the Relay list *only* relay email FROM hosts whom's IP addresses are listed in the
Relay field?
